 This car is up for sale as my father has decided that it is time for him to rid of the majority of his car collection.

This car is 1986 Pontiac Fiero 2M6 SE.  This car has the uncommon, powerful, and reliable 2.8L V6 paired to an automatic transmission.  The cars runs and drives just as it should.  The transmission shifts on time and smoothly.

The car has just under 78,000 ACTUAL miles and the condition of the car is consistent with this low mileage.

It is pewter in color with a light tan interior.  In my opinion, both the exterior and the interior are in exceptional condition.  The paint is near flawless.  The interior is super clean.  The headliner is the only aspect of the interior that needs any attention at all.

The car has power windows as well as power locks.

The car has a sunroof but I am unsure as to whether or not this is a factory option.  Either way, it looks as if it was factory installed and it experiences absolutely NO leaks.

The car does have an aftermarket stereo head unit that functions as it should.  This is the only aftermarket aspect of the interior.  The only aftermarket aspect of the exterior is the protective bra on the front of the car.

The pop-up headlights function properly.  I know that it is a common issue for these not to function properly on the Fieros.

The tires have roughly 80% tread life left.  If I were buying the car, I would possibly consider having the wheels refinished although the current condition of the wheels may not bother you.

The air conditioner will need to be charged.

The car is believed to have three or four total owners with the most recent owner being a retired state policeman that really cared for the car.

We have a good amount of the original literature that came with the car from new that will accompany the car.  The car carries a clean and clear title that is ready for transfer to a new owner.  The car has no major issues or problems and no issue or problems that affect the drivability of the car.

Saturn Vue ignition switch leads to new group of GM recalls totaling 312k

Fri, 08 Aug 2014

General Motors has another spate of recalls to announce. This time they cover 312,280 vehicles worldwide, including 269,041 of in the US, in a total of six campaigns. In 2014, the automaker has recalled 29,079,765 vehicles worldwide, with 25,754,356 of those in the US.
The largest among them covers 215,243 units of the Saturn Vue from 2002-2004 model years worldwide, 202,115 in the US. It's possible for the for the key to be removed even when the ignition isn't in the OFF position. The company knows of two crashes and one injury caused by this problem. Dealers are checking the parts and replacing the ignition cylinder and key set, if necessary.
Next is 72,826 models worldwide (48,059 vehicles in the US) of the 2013 Cadillac ATS four-door sedan, 2013 Buick Encore and 2013 Chevy Trax in Canada. It's possible that the for lap belt pretensioner to retract but not to lock, which could increase occupant movement during a crash. Both front, outboard lap belt pretensioners are being replaced, and a stop-sale is in effect on unsold models until the problem is repaired. There are no known crashes or injuries, though.

GM recalling 8.4M cars, 8.2M related to ignition problems

Mon, 30 Jun 2014

General Motors today announced a truly massive recall covering some 8.4 million vehicles in North America. Most significantly, 8.2 million examples of the affected vehicles are being called back due to "unintended ignition key rotation," though GM spokesperson Alan Adler tells Autoblog that this issue is not like the infamous Chevy Cobalt ignition switch fiasco.
For the sake of perspective, translated to US population, this total recall figure would equal a car for each resident of New Hampshire, Rhode Island, Montana, Delaware, South Dakota, Alaska, North Dakota, the District of Columbia, Vermont and Wyoming. Combined. Here's how it all breaks down:
7,610,862 vehicles in North America being recalled for unintended ignition key rotation. 6,805,679 are in the United States.

There are few things simultaneously more romantic and idiotic than taking a road trip in a beaten-down heap of a car. Trust us. We know. David Freiburger and Mike Finnegan of Hot Rod Magazine fame recently undertook an epic trip from El Paso, Texas to Los Angeles with the express goal of doing so for under $1,500, including the purchase price of a vehicle, food, lodging, repairs and, most importantly, fuel. With this in mind, the duo settled on a 1972 Pontiac Catalina for a lofty $650. Hilarity ensues.
Realizing that no one actually wants a Catalina sulking around the shop, Freiburger and Finnegan put the car up for auction on eBay Motors the instant they had the title in hand. By the time they rolled into Hot Rod HQ, the vehicle sold for a little over $500.
